Understanding the Basics: What Are Diamonds?

The Science of Diamonds

Diamonds are formed from carbon atoms that undergo immense pressure and heat, resulting in the crystalline structure that gives diamonds their stunning brilliance. There are two primary avenues through which diamonds can be obtained: natural mining and laboratory creation.

  • Natural Diamonds: Formed naturally over billions of years deep within the Earth’s mantle, these diamonds are extracted through mining processes that can have significant environmental and ethical implications.
  • Lab-Grown Diamonds: Created in controlled environments using advanced technology that replicates the natural formation process, lab-grown diamonds share the same physical and chemical properties as mined diamonds.

Understanding the fundamental differences between these two types of diamonds sets the stage for our exploration of their pricing structures.

The 4Cs of Diamonds

When considering any diamond purchase, it's essential to familiarize ourselves with the 4Cs: Carat, Cut, Color, and Clarity. These factors not only influence the beauty of the diamond but also its price.

  • Carat: Refers to the weight of the diamond. Larger diamonds are rarer and thus more expensive.
  • Cut: The quality of how the diamond is cut affects its overall appearance. An expertly cut diamond will reflect light beautifully, enhancing its brilliance.
  • Color: Diamonds are graded on a scale from D (colorless) to Z (noticeable color). Generally, colorless diamonds are more valuable.
  • Clarity: This refers to the presence of inclusions or blemishes in a diamond. Higher clarity grades are associated with greater value.

The Cost Comparison: Lab-Grown vs. Natural Diamonds

Price Differences

A significant factor that draws many consumers to lab-grown diamonds is the stark difference in pricing. On average, lab-grown diamonds can cost anywhere from 60% to 85% less than natural diamonds. This drastic reduction in price can be attributed to several factors:

Production Efficiency

The process of creating lab-grown diamonds is considerably more efficient than mining natural diamonds. While natural diamonds take billions of years to form, lab-grown diamonds are produced in a matter of weeks. Supply and Demand Dynamics

The market for natural diamonds is tightly regulated, leading to an artificially inflated demand. In contrast, lab-grown diamonds are experiencing a rapid increase in production capacity, leading to a more competitive market. As more manufacturers enter the space, prices continue to decrease, making them a more attractive option for consumers.

Example Pricing Scenarios

To illustrate the cost differences, let’s take a look at some typical examples:

  • A 1-carat natural diamond with a high-quality cut, color, and clarity can cost approximately £4,200.
  • The equivalent 1-carat lab-grown diamond might only cost around £1,000.

This substantial price gap exemplifies why many consumers are turning to lab-grown options without sacrificing quality or aesthetics.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Are lab-grown diamonds real diamonds?

Yes, lab-grown diamonds are real diamonds. They are made of the same carbon structure as natural diamonds and exhibit identical optical properties. The only difference lies in their origin—lab-grown diamonds are created in controlled environments, while natural diamonds are formed over billions of years in the Earth’s mantle.

Why are lab-grown diamonds cheaper than natural diamonds?

Lab-grown diamonds are generally cheaper due to the more efficient production process and the competitive market dynamics. They can be produced in weeks, while natural diamonds take billions of years to form. Additionally, the regulated supply of natural diamonds often leads to higher prices.

Do lab-grown diamonds retain their value?

Lab-grown diamonds typically do not retain their value as well as natural diamonds. While natural diamonds can often be resold for a percentage of their original price, lab-grown diamonds usually have lower resale values.
